Lub Linux faib dawb kiag li Hyperbola tau hloov mus rau hauv rab rawg ntawm OpenBSD

Qhov project Hyperbola, ib feem ntawm Open Source Foundation-txhawb qhov project daim ntawv teev tag nrho pub dawb distributions, luam tawm npaj rau kev hloov mus rau kev siv cov ntsiav thiab cov neeg siv khoom siv los ntawm OpenBSD nrog rau kev xa khoom ntawm qee yam khoom los ntawm lwm lub tshuab BSD. Qhov kev faib tawm tshiab yog npaj yuav muab faib raws li lub npe HyperbolaBSD.

HyperbolaBSD tau npaj yuav tsim los ua tag nrho cov nkhaus ntawm OpenBSD, uas yuav nthuav dav nrog cov cai tshiab muab raws li GPLv3 thiab LGPLv3 cov ntawv tso cai. Txoj cai tsim nyob rau sab saum toj ntawm OpenBSD yuav yog tsom rau maj mam hloov cov khoom siv OpenBSD faib raws li cov ntawv tso cai uas tsis sib haum nrog GPL. Yav dhau los tsim Hyperbola GNU / Linux-libre ceg yuav khaws cia kom txog rau thaum 2022, tab sis yav tom ntej Hyperbola tso tawm yuav raug tsiv mus rau cov tshiab kernel thiab cov ntsiab lus.

Kev tsis txaus siab nrog cov qauv hauv Linux kernel kev txhim kho yog raug suav tias yog vim li cas rau kev hloov mus rau OpenBSD codebase:

  • Kev txais yuav kev tiv thaiv kev cai lij choj (DRM) rau hauv Linux ntsiav, piv txwv li, cov ntsiav yog suav nrog kev txhawb nqa rau HDCP (High-bandwidth Digital Content Protection) luam thev naus laus zis tiv thaiv rau cov ntsiab lus suab thiab video.
  • Kev loj hlob pib tsim cov tsav tsheb rau Linux ntsiav hauv Rust. Cov neeg tsim khoom Hyperbola tsis zoo siab nrog kev siv lub hauv paus ntawm Cargo repository thiab teeb meem nrog rau kev ywj pheej los faib cov pob khoom nrog Rust. Tshwj xeeb, cov ntsiab lus ntawm kev siv cov khoom lag luam Rust thiab Cargo txwv tsis pub khaws cov npe ntawm qhov project thaum muaj kev hloov pauv lossis thaj ua rau thaj (ib pob tuaj yeem muab faib rau hauv lub npe Rust thiab Cargo tsuas yog muab tso ua ke los ntawm thawj qhov chaws, txwv tsis pub yuav tsum tau tau txais kev tso cai ua ntej los ntawm pab pawg Rust Core lossis hloov npe).
  • Linux kernel kev txhim kho yam tsis xav txog kev ruaj ntseg (Grsecurity tsis yog qhov project dawb lawm, thiab pib KSPP (Kernel Self Protection Project) yog stagnating).
  • Ntau GNU cov neeg siv ib puag ncig cov khoom siv thiab cov khoom siv hluav taws xob pib tsim cov haujlwm tsis tsim nyog yam tsis muaj txoj hauv kev los cuam tshuam nws thaum tsim lub sijhawm. Raws li ib qho piv txwv, kev faib tawm ntawm qhov yuav tsum tau muaj kev vam meej yog muab PulseAudio hauv gnome-control-center, SystemD hauv GNOME, xeb hauv Firefox thiab Java hauv gettext.

Cia peb nco ntsoov koj tias Hyperbola project yog tsim los ua raws li KISS (Keep It Simple Stupid) lub hauv paus ntsiab lus thiab yog tsom rau kev muab cov neeg siv nrog qhov yooj yim, hnav, ruaj khov thiab nyab xeeb. Yav dhau los, qhov kev faib tawm tau tsim los ntawm qhov chaw ruaj khov ntawm Arch Linux pob lub hauv paus, nrog qee qhov kev hloov pauv los ntawm Debian los txhim kho kev ruaj ntseg thiab kev ruaj ntseg. Qhov kev pib ua haujlwm yog ua raws li sysvinit nrog kev xa khoom ntawm qee qhov kev txhim kho los ntawm Devuan thiab Parabola cov haujlwm. Lub sijhawm tso nyiaj txhawb nqa yog 5 xyoos.

Tau qhov twg los: opennet.ru

Ntxiv ib saib